Reynel Gonzalez (CRD #: 5284130), a broker registered with Truist Investment Services, has voluntarily resigned from Wells Fargo Clearing Services. This disclosure appears on his BrokerCheck record, accessed on November 5, 2025. Keep reading if you have questions.

Employment Separation After Allegations

On September 19, 2025, Reynel Gonzalez voluntarily resigned from Wells Fargo Clearing Services. At the time, the firm alleges it was reviewing concerns involving communications with a client through a non-firm-approved channel and a failure to report a complaint.

High Standards of Commercial Honor

FINRA Rule 2010 holds brokers to high standards of commercial honor and just and equitable principles of trade. Using a non-firm-approved channel and a failure to report a complaint may violate this rule.
